#f5ebf9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5ebf9 is composed of 96.1% red, 92.2%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 5.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 282.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 94.9%. #f5ebf9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ebd7f3. Closest websafe color is: #ffffff.

Shades and Tints of #f5ebf9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08030a is the darkest color, while #fdfafe is the lightest one.
